What are the key types of structured data for on-page SEO?
Structured data for on-page SEO primarily includes formats that help search engines understand the content of a webpage better. The most common types are Schema.org markup, JSON-LD format, and Microdata implementation, each offering unique benefits and methods for enhancing visibility in search results.
Schema.org markup
Schema.org markup is a collaborative initiative by major search engines to create a common vocabulary for structured data. By using this markup, website owners can provide explicit information about their content, such as products, reviews, events, and more. Implementing Schema.org can lead to rich snippets in search results, improving click-through rates.
To use Schema.org markup effectively, identify the type of content you want to mark up and select the appropriate schema type. Tools like Google’s Structured Data Markup Helper can assist in generating the necessary code. Always validate your markup with the Rich Results Test to ensure it is correctly implemented.
JSON-LD format
JSON-LD (JavaScript Object Notation for Linked Data) is a lightweight format for encoding linked data using JSON. It is recommended by Google for structured data implementation due to its ease of use and flexibility. JSON-LD can be added to the head of your HTML document, making it less intrusive compared to other formats.
When using JSON-LD, structure your data in key-value pairs that clearly define the entities and their relationships. For example, if you have a local business, you can include information like the business name, address, and opening hours. This format is particularly beneficial for developers as it separates data from HTML content, simplifying updates and maintenance.
Microdata implementation
Microdata is an HTML specification used to nest metadata within existing content on web pages. It allows you to annotate your HTML elements with attributes that provide additional context to search engines. While effective, Microdata can be more complex to implement than JSON-LD, as it requires modifying the HTML structure directly.
To implement Microdata, you must identify the relevant HTML elements and add the appropriate attributes, such as itemscope, itemtype, and itemprop. This method can be beneficial for smaller websites or specific content types, but it may complicate the HTML and make it harder to manage as your site grows. Always test your Microdata with Google’s Structured Data Testing Tool to ensure accuracy.

How to implement structured data on your website?
Implementing structured data on your website enhances its visibility in search results by providing search engines with clear information about your content. This can lead to rich snippets, which improve click-through rates and user engagement.
Using Google Tag Manager
Google Tag Manager (GTM) simplifies the process of adding structured data without modifying your website’s code directly. You can create a new tag for structured data, select the appropriate JSON-LD format, and set triggers to control when it fires.
To get started, ensure you have GTM installed on your site. Then, create a new tag, choose ‘Custom HTML’, and paste your structured data code. Test it using GTM’s preview mode to verify that it works as intended.
